Multiple Slit Diffraction

A Cornell plate provides multiple-slit patterns and gratings of various densities. Students observe how increasing the number of slits sharpens the principal maxima while keeping their angular positions fixed, and …

Lasers and White Light

Compares diffraction of three individual laser wavelengths (red, green, blue) with white light from a slide projector through the same grating. Students see discrete laser spots at specific angles alongside …

Transmission Gratings

Demonstrates how grating line density affects angular separation of diffraction orders. Comparing 100, 300, and 600 lines/mm gratings with a laser, students directly observe that higher line density (smaller) produces …

LED Tower

A vertical array of eleven labeled LEDs spanning the visible spectrum (400–640 nm plus white) provides a concrete reference for wavelength-color relationships. Used with a diffraction grating, students can verify …

Diffraction from a Machinist's Scale

A laser beam grazes a machinist's scale at a shallow angle, and the regularly spaced rulings act as a reflection diffraction grating. Students see multiple diffraction orders and can connect …

CD as Reflection Grating

A CD's regularly spaced tracks (~1.6 μm pitch) act as a reflection diffraction grating, producing multiple visible diffraction orders from a laser beam. Students connect microscopic periodic structure to the …

Diffraction from a Phonograph Record

Demonstrates diffraction from a reflection grating using a vinyl record's groove structure. Students observe multiple diffraction orders and connect everyday objects to wave optics principles.

Diffraction through Mesh

Laser light through circular apertures (0.04 and 0.08 mm) and mesh screens produces Fraunhofer diffraction patterns, demonstrating light's wave nature. Students observe Airy patterns and two-dimensional grating patterns, and verify …
